2. How much does hiring an Alberta car accident lawyer cost?
Most car accident lawyers in Alberta work on a contingency fee basis. This means they only get paid if they win your case and obtain compensation for you. The fee is typically a percentage of the settlement or verdict amount and will be discussed and agreed upon before the lawyer takes on your case.
3. What is the time limit for filing a car accident claim in Alberta?
In Alberta, the Limitations Act sets a general limitation period of two years for personal injury claims, including car accident claims. It is crucial to initiate the legal process within this timeframe to preserve your right to seek compensation.
4. How long does it take to resolve a car accident claim in Alberta?
The duration of a car accident claim in Alberta can vary depending on various factors, including the complexity of the case, the severity of injuries, and the willingness of the insurance company to negotiate. Some cases settle within a few months, while others may take years to reach a resolution.
5. Will my car accident case go to trial?
Most car accident cases in Alberta are resolved through settlement negotiations. However, if a fair settlement cannot be reached, your case may proceed to trial. An experienced car accident lawyer will be prepared to represent you in court, if necessary.
